    The last I knew for less than four targets you are better setting your DoTs individually using three Painflares in-between. For more four or more enemies you would use Bane, Painflare, Painflare. This should get you to DWT where you would use Tri-bind until Deathflare. I usually single target Ruin III > Ruin II/IV while waiting for AoE oGCD to be ready as it gets an enemy down faster than the 30 potency spread across x number of enemies. This could be wrong as I'm not into the math but anecdotally things seem to go faster. During this I am weaving pet and Shadowflare actions as available.

    As far as AoE goes, I've found Tri-Bind is only worth it if
    A.) You're up against 5+ mobs, or
    B.) If you're in DTW fighting 3+ mobs since the trance boosts Tri-Bind's potency from 30 to 100.

    Other than that, apply your DoTs+Bane, use Ruin 3 + Ruin 2, and Painflare, and of course Deathflare when you're wrapping up DWT. Don't forget about your pet's Enkindle for AoEs too!

    And as for single-targeting, the basic rotation I tend to follow after Aetherflow is Tri-D >Fester >R3+R2 >Fester >R3+R2 >Fester >DWT > R3X6 (weaving Tri-D if needed) >Deathflare. Repeat that process once more, then wait for Aetherflow to come off cd while keeping up DoTs, weaving R2 and OGCDs, and doing R3+R2 during the downtime. Then you can summon Bahaumt after you refresh your Aether stacks, Fester+R2 > Akh Morn, then weave R2 with Fester, Addle, and Tri-D at the end before the second Akh Morn. You get another round of downtime (this time without worrying about DoTs hopefully) until Aetherflow is about 17 seconds before it comes off cd, then you can use the DWT you built up during Bahamut.

    To be honest, I'm still practicing that single rotation myself since I'm also pretty new, but that's the gist I've picked up reading guides (which seem to be the same ones others provided to you earlier, actually). But while you're still leveling, mostly just focus on DoTs, R3+R2 and Fester, then DWT >R3X6, all while weaving in OGCDs when available and you should be fine I think.
